Claire
9080083263
Merge commit '341ea7f462c68ebe2fc5ee15dc7c58aa5775d5a0' into glitch-soc/merge-upstream
2025-10-20 21:37:50 +02:00
Ben Sheldon [he/him]
843c43c97a
Replace ThreadingHelper wait loop with functional CyclicBarrier ( #36508 )
2025-10-20 10:10:43 +00:00
Claire
ef413ef713
Merge commit '5a8ab0a3e62a8825e28bb74c1760ba6488d20c97' into glitch-soc/merge-upstream
2025-10-15 16:35:37 +02:00
Claire
fab0dd0bcf
Change redirection for denied registration from web app to sign-in page with error message ( #36384 )
2025-10-15 11:37:22 +00:00
Claire
264d068d8d
Change new accounts to use new ActivityPub numeric ID scheme ( #36365 )
2025-10-14 16:36:55 +00:00
Claire
302e3fe8be
Merge commit '50743cc35be19deae9356bd21f1143e3a9b4fbb8' into glitch-soc/merge-upstream
2025-10-14 18:01:40 +02:00
Claire
fd516347cb
Fix deletion of posts quoting soft-deleted local post ( #36461 )
2025-10-14 15:15:38 +00:00
Claire
44ecc4b1e3
Fix moderation warning e-mails that include posts ( #36462 )
2025-10-14 11:48:51 +00:00
Claire
af82db5271
Merge commit 'edd7fd98722a0d49ea486aa790a186735e491f35' into glitch-soc/merge-upstream
2025-10-13 18:07:08 +02:00
Eugen Rochko
33f739da44
Fix permalink redirects continuing to work for suspended accounts ( #36453 )
2025-10-13 15:18:01 +00:00
Claire
be762da45f
Merge commit '254fff93ca3604438a94a453bedfe6f499e2cd66' into glitch-soc/merge-upstream
2025-10-13 16:51:40 +02:00
Claire
2971ac9863
Fix streaming still being authorized for suspended accounts ( #36448 )
2025-10-13 13:35:44 +00:00
Claire
8921494571
Merge commit '7e98fa9b476fdaed235519f1d527eb956004ba0c' into glitch-soc/merge-upstream
2025-10-13 14:26:11 +02:00
Emelia Smith
7e98fa9b47
Merge commit from fork
...
* Require read, read:statuses or read:notifications scope to access streaming APIs
* Add additional tests for scope-based channel access
We were missing tests in the affirmative for subscribing to the user:notification channel, this adds them
2025-10-13 14:20:57 +02:00
Emelia Smith
24dcb18013
Merge commit from fork
...
* Ensure tootctl revokes sessions, access tokens and web push subscriptions
* Fix test coverage
2025-10-13 14:20:23 +02:00
Emelia Smith
8d09e4ef23
Merge commit from fork
...
* Streaming: Ensure disabled users cannot connect to streaming
* Streaming: Disconnect when the user is disabled
2025-10-13 14:19:14 +02:00
Claire
490c89a5a9
Merge commit 'c858fc77ef194be0217fd98eae84efd261dba798' into glitch-soc/merge-upstream
2025-10-09 17:59:13 +02:00
Claire
d4a4a7177a
Fix crash when serializing quotes of deleted posts for ActivityPub ( #36381 )
2025-10-09 13:52:38 +00:00
Matt Jankowski
0152659245
Use tag filter for pending tag count on admin dashboard ( #36404 )
2025-10-09 08:08:29 +00:00
Claire
f800057008
Merge commit 'b8444d9bb7885d75112a3cae74b6a5c711c7d547' into glitch-soc/merge-upstream
2025-10-08 18:07:04 +02:00
Claire
0be0a8898a
Fix Update/Delete of quoted status not being forwarded to quoters's followers ( #36390 )
2025-10-08 12:56:32 +00:00
Renaud Chaput
e8dab026bb
Fix quote mailer preview to use the latest quote notification ( #36373 )
2025-10-07 10:19:53 +00:00
Claire
73a625c284
Merge commit '4dc21d7afdb485402555908bc72d071f8b25ec36' into glitch-soc/merge-upstream
...
Conflicts:
- `config/settings.yml`:
Upstream replaced a setting with 4 new ones, while glitch-soc had modified
the default value of that setting.
Removed the old setting and added the new settings, but with defaults
matching glitch-soc's previous behavior.
2025-10-06 19:24:16 +02:00
Claire
2d2c525097
Split timeline_preview setting into more granular settings ( #36338 )
2025-10-06 08:34:05 +00:00
Claire
17e0c745c6
Merge commit 'f69ca085dbfca2253404574dcdc4dc6c2aaa35c0' into glitch-soc/merge-upstream
2025-10-01 19:13:18 +02:00
Claire
cbb94bdfde
Merge commit '45219dbf64805746a472e50bb7c9bcb52972ab2a' into glitch-soc/merge-upstream
2025-09-30 18:06:45 +02:00
Claire
5af40ff960
Fix some routes for numeric AP identifiers ( #36304 )
2025-09-30 15:09:59 +00:00
Claire
589af7a1cc
Change GET /api/v1/statuses/:id/quotes to allow listing quotes to other people's posts ( #36291 )
2025-09-30 09:56:03 +00:00
Claire
45219dbf64
Fix spurious notification of local boosters and quoters when updating quote policy ( #36299 )
2025-09-30 09:40:58 +00:00
Emelia Smith
5b97f25a15
Add integration tests for mastodon-streaming ( #36025 )
...
Co-authored-by: Claire <claire.github-309c@sitedethib.com >
Co-authored-by: David Roetzel <david@roetzel.de >
2025-09-30 07:27:09 +00:00
Claire
b6c53c1129
Merge commit '150f0fcba5585782e2cac49d971904f02d5e6fbd' into glitch-soc/merge-upstream
...
Conflicts:
- `app/controllers/follower_accounts_controller.rb`:
Upstream refactored a part of the code where glitch-soc has changed the code
to potentially hide followers count.
Adapt upstream's changes.
2025-09-29 18:41:46 +02:00
Claire
150f0fcba5
Add support for numeric-based URIs for local accounts ( #32724 )
2025-09-29 12:05:48 +00:00
Claire
106b0a9d93
Merge commit 'a44a3f6d4047568921469ff9fbd212f553b1e7f4' into glitch-soc/merge-upstream
2025-09-27 21:46:57 +02:00
Claire
a44a3f6d40
Expand test coverage of ActivityPub::TagManager class ( #36260 )
2025-09-26 10:00:53 +00:00
Claire
b15b07606c
Merge commit '28be5a199f685b9fb26742c4d78ddca53df05d57' into glitch-soc/merge-upstream
2025-09-24 18:26:13 +02:00
Claire
28be5a199f
Fix Private Messages self-quoting private posts being changed to followers-only ( #36249 )
2025-09-24 10:58:52 +00:00
Claire
e1f7847b64
Remove the outgoing_quotes feature flag, making the feature unconditional ( #36130 )
2025-09-24 08:58:08 +00:00
Claire
880e662a60
Merge commit '854aaec6fe69df02e6d850cb90eef37032b4d72f' into glitch-soc/merge-upstream
2025-09-19 18:18:56 +02:00
Matt Jankowski
854aaec6fe
Spec for newline in request lib initialize ( #36170 )
2025-09-19 15:22:23 +00:00
Claire
b6bc42aaa6
Fix getting Create and Update out of order ( #36176 )
2025-09-19 08:45:13 +00:00
Claire
16e479e3ec
Merge commit '90765342a35abd6883e57f5419342f491b83e250' into glitch-soc/merge-upstream
2025-09-17 21:46:08 +02:00
Claire
90765342a3
Fix posts when omitting quote policy and default policy is nobody ( #36158 )
2025-09-17 19:16:36 +00:00
Claire
3a31ef11cc
Merge commit 'db0cd9489c70e985da961a585f3a809ca449dccf' into glitch-soc/merge-upstream
...
Conflicts:
- `app/services/post_status_service.rb`:
Upstream updated the logic to move the CW to the text content.
Glitch-soc does not move CW to text content but has some logic
to avoid the text being empty. Update the logic according to upstream's
change.
- `docker-compose.yml`:
Conflict because of different paths for composer images.
Updated version as upstream did while keeping our path.
2025-09-17 20:10:28 +02:00
Claire
210786efd8
Merge commit '2664bb628b7bf77b9efa4143423486cf16d17ba7' into glitch-soc/merge-upstream
2025-09-17 18:17:18 +02:00
Claire
fbf093a87f
Fix CW being moved to text when posting quote posts with empty text ( #36151 )
2025-09-17 12:19:00 +00:00
Jeong Arm
3055afd1d2
Fix applying user's default quote policy if API parameter is not specified ( #36132 )
2025-09-17 07:08:55 +00:00
Claire
5da295fa4d
Merge commit '06803422da3794538cd9cd5c7ccd61a0694ef921' into glitch-soc/merge-upstream
2025-09-13 11:12:22 +02:00
Claire
82b26603fe
Fix quote posts with CW and no text being rejected ( #36095 )
2025-09-12 13:10:31 +00:00
Claire
128a69c1f4
Merge commit '75f78244d5df52cc8242b6a7c6b8d1531963aa63' into glitch-soc/merge-upstream
2025-09-11 12:13:47 +02:00
Claire
b60ee191ac
Fix QuoteAuthorization id not being properly serialized when federating revocation ( #36083 )
2025-09-11 09:37:56 +00:00